Comprehending Company Liquidation Process



The procedure of firm liquidation entails the organized winding down and dissolution of a business entity to resolve its financial debts and distribute any remaining properties to stakeholders in conformity with relevant laws and laws. The liquidator's primary duties include recognizing the firm's properties, paying off lenders in a specific order of top priority, and dispersing any type of excess to the shareholders.




During the liquidation process, the firm discontinues its normal organization operations, and its focus changes to the organized negotiation of debts and commitments. Inevitably, the goal of company liquidation is to bring closure to the service entity while complying with legal needs and shielding the rate of interests of stakeholders.


Worker Rights and Privileges



Upon business liquidation, workers are entitled to particular civil liberties and benefits that should be respected and satisfied according to relevant labor legislations and laws. One of the key privileges for staff members in the occasion of business liquidation is the settlement of impressive salaries and wages. This consists of any unsettled salaries, perks, or benefits that the workers have gained approximately the day of the liquidation.

Effect On Worker Finances



Staff members facing company liquidation frequently experience considerable economic obstacles due to unpredictabilities surrounding their future earnings and benefits. One immediate issue is the possible additional reading loss of income and superior repayments, such as commissions or benefits, as the liquidation procedure unfolds. Sometimes, staff members might likewise deal with difficulties in accessing funds held in retirement accounts or other lasting savings plans if the company's monetary circumstance endangers these advantages.


Moreover, the discontinuation of medical insurance protection as a result of the firm's liquidation can further stress employees' funds, particularly if they require to seek alternative protection at a greater price. The sudden loss of employment might likewise affect workers' capacity to fulfill their economic commitments, such as rent or home loan repayments, funding payments, and other necessary expenditures.


Browsing Unemployment Insurance



Navigating the complexities of looking for and receiving welfare can be an essential step for people impacted by company liquidation. When a firm enters into liquidation, workers may discover themselves instantly without a work and unpredictable concerning their monetary security. In such scenarios, comprehending just how to accessibility welfare becomes important.


Employees influenced by business liquidation need to without delay apply for unemployment insurance through their state's labor department. The application procedure generally involves providing info about the business, the reason for task loss, and personal information. It is essential to properly complete all kinds and submit any type of needed documentation to stay clear of delays in obtaining benefits.


Once approved, individuals may obtain financial support for a restricted period while they look for brand-new work chances. It is essential to actively look for work and accomplish any added requirements set by the unemployment find out here office to stay eligible for advantages. Browsing welfare during firm liquidation can offer an important security web for people encountering unexpected task loss and monetary uncertainty.
